Use SmartDay as an organizational tool by attaching notes and documents to events, and even include checklists within your notes. The auto-schedule feature allows you to place tasks into a timeline so you can easily view deadlines and identify how many tasks you can complete in a day or week. You can change due dates by dragging and dropping tasks onto specific days uncompleted tasks will automatically be moved to the next day. This calendar app doubles as a task manager.
It includes all the typical calendar views (day, week, month, and year), and also adds a List view.
